Free Movies in Millcreek: Venture Out!

The highlight of the nights activities will be the popular 2004 film documenting the life of a superhero family, The Incredibles. This will be a fun movie for the adults and the kids. Activities will begin at 6PM. There will be food trucks so be sure to come out, grab a bit to eat and catch an incredible movie with the family.

  • Location: Big Cottonwood Park, 4300 S 1300 E
  • Time: 6PM
  • August 10th: The Incredibles

Free Movies at Snowbird: Family Flicks

Both movies that will be showing are hardcore throwbacks to the glory days of the movie industry. The first movie in the park will be Ghostbusters. The highly popular 1984 movie featuring Bill Murray, Dan Akroid and Harold Ramis follows three ghost detectives investigating a ghost epidemic in the city. The second movie, Footloose, will no doubt bring feelings of nostalgia. Come watch as Kevin Bacon dances his way through a city that has outlawed dancing. This will be a great opportunity to bring the family up to the mountains and get a much needed break from the heat.

  • Location: Snowbird Plaza Deck
  • Time: 8PM
  • August 3rd: Ghostbusters
  • August 10th: Footloose

Free Movies at Snowbasin: Movies On The Mountains

free moviesThe lineup Snowbasin has put together are movies that are all very popular and have come out recently. Coco, Guardians of the Galaxy Vol. 2, Star Wars: The Last Jedi and Avengers: Infinity War will all playing playing at this unique experience in the mountains. We’re starting to give you way too many reasons to get away from the summer heat and chill out in the mountains. Activities will start around 4:30 PM and there will be food available at Snowbasin.

  • Location: Snowbasin, 3925 E Snowbasin Rd
  • Time: 6PM
  • July 30th: Coco
  • August 6th: Guardians of the Galaxy Vol. 2
  • August 13th: Star Wars: The Last Jedi
  • August 20th: The Avengers: Infinity War
